Where does everyone keep coming up with 2 first round picks traded for Roy Williams?

For the record

The Lions received the Cowboys' 2009 first-round pick, a third-round pick and sixth-round pick. The Cowboys get Detroit's 2009 seventh-round pick in the Williams trade.

So in essence, Dallas traded a first and a third for Williams.
And they traded thier 6th round pick in exchange for Detroits 7th round pick.

Only 2 draft picks were traded for Roy Williams.
